BACKGROUND: Eye-related symptoms are a common presentation in the emergency department (ED). The cases range from simple viral conjunctivitis to trauma-related eye injuries. One pathological condition that could lead to vision loss is retinal artery occlusion (RAO). Evaluating a patient with an eye symptom requires thorough eye examination and advanced imaging in certain instances. Consultation with an ophthalmologist is also necessary for cases that require treatment recommendations and further testing. In the ED, point-of-care ultrasound (POCUS) is a commonly used diagnostic tool that can be used for ocular examination. CASE REPORT: We reported a case of a 60-year-old man who presented with painless partial right-eye vision loss. POCUS showed decreased flow in the right central retinal artery with an area of the pale retina seen on the image from the retinal camera, suggesting a possible branch RAO. Further examination with POCUS showed plaque formation at the carotid bifurcation, a potential cause of the patient's symptoms. WHY SHOULD AN EMERGENCY PHYSICIAN BE AWARE OF THIS?: Emergency physicians and other providers should be encouraged to use POCUS to diagnose eye symptoms accurately and promptly. Abnormal findings will prompt immediate specialty consult and early appropriate management. Our case and other reported cases highlight POCUS's reliability and rapid diagnostic ability.

BACKGROUND: Traumatic epidural hematoma (EDH) with the potential to displace the brain tissue and increase intracranial pressure (ICP), is a life-threatening condition that requires emergent intervention. In rare circumstances, Emergency Physician (EP) may have to do skull trephination to reduce the ICP as a temporary measure. SPECIFIC AIMS: To evaluate emergency medicine (EM) residents' comfort in performing emergency department (ED) burr holes and to assess their difficulties and evaluate comfort level before and after simulated EDH cases. MATERIALS AND METHODS: A 3D-printed skull, electrical and manual drills were used for the simulation. Subjective comfort level pre and post-procedure, as well as objective procedural skills and time to complete the drill, were recorded. RESULTS: Twenty EM residents participated in the simulation study. The median time to perforate through the skull was 4 s for the electric drill and 10 s for the manual drill. A comfort level of 5 and above was reported by 12 participants for the manual drill and by 17 participants for the electric drill. Six participants had mild and 2 participants had moderate observed difficulty in handling the manual and electric drill. Most participants performed both procedures successfully with one attempt only. Three participants have an overall comfort level above 5 before the simulation and 13 participants had overall comfort level above 5 post-simulation. CONCLUSION: The 3D-printed model assisted the ED burr hole simulation and the residents could perform the procedure with minimum difficulties.

BACKGROUND: Anterior shoulder dislocation is a common presentation to the emergency department (ED). Dislocations are spontaneous or traumatic. Generally, a reduction is performed under procedural sedation and analgesia (PSA). Other approaches include the use of intra-articular lidocaine or, in rare instances, nerve blocks. Here we discuss the case of a 66-year-old female patient who presented with left shoulder pain and limited range of motion after a fall. After discussing potential treatment options to reduce the dislocation, the patient agreed to a nerve block. DISCUSSION: The dislocation was reduced successfully with a suprascapular nerve block (SSNB) without complications. The duration of the patient's ED stay was shorter than those who had received PSA. CONCLUSIONS: SSNB could be an alternative method for shoulder dislocation reduction, particularly for patients who are obese, older, or have cardiopulmonary comorbidities.

Tracheal masses are rare in occurrence, but could lead to complications depending on the speed of growth, duration and degree of obstruction. Some of the complications are recurrent pneumonia and air trapping resulting in increased intrathoracic pressure. The latter phenomenon can result in obstruction of the venous return and pneumothorax. We are reporting a rare presentation of bilateral pneumothorax (presumed tensioned) in a young patient with a distal obstructive tracheal tumor. In the emergency department (ED) the patient was in respiratory distress and was found to have extensive subcutaneous emphysema of the neck, chest, and abdominal wall with hypotension. Respiratory failure from bilateral tension pneumothorax was suspected and the patient was intubated with simultaneous bilateral thoracostomy. These measures did not improve the patient's ventilation and oxygenation status. Further fiberoptic investigation revealed a distal tracheal obstructive mass. An emergency surgical intervention was required to remove the tumor. We recommend considering alternative pathologies, such as an obstructive tracheal tumor, in a patient with respiratory distress. They should especially be considered when oxygenation and ventilation are difficult, particularly when endotracheal intubation and/or tube thoracostomy fail to improve the symptoms. A high index of suspicion and a timely multidisciplinary team approach are essential when managing the life-threatening presentation of a patient with a distal tracheal tumor.
